Claiming some fifteen million members, Scientology is an outgrowth of a research study called Dianetics, launched by L. Ron Hubbard. An accomplished scientific research fiction and unique author in the 1930s, Hubbard released a non-fiction publication in 1948 qualified Dianetics: The Modern Science of Mental Wellness. In this publication, the author offered ideas and methods for promoting mental, psychological and spiritual excellence.


The trainings of Scientology are not theological (God-centered) in nature, however instead state a method of taking full advantage of individual potential. Scientology method purposes to uncover and eliminate accumulated negative and unpleasant experiences in the soul of the seeker. Many of these "engrams," as they are called, are believed to be received by the embryo in the womb or in a wide range of past lives.




The clearing of engrams from previous lives appears very closely associated to the Hindu doctrine of fate and reincarnation. The concept of "karma" educates that a private soul, throughout numerous lifetimes, experiences rewards and penalties in order to eventually stabilize past and present deeds (Scientology). The E-meter (or Electro-psychometer) is the auditor's tool and is used as a confessional help in Scientology. It is a type of lie detector that sends out a mild electrical current through the body of the Applicant. Scientologists believe that the E-Meter has the ability to find Body Thetans and past psychological traumas whether they occurred yesterday or in a previous life numerous years back.
